Describe, with the aid of a diagram, the process of magnetic separation.

Magnetic separation is a process used to separate magnetic materials from non-magnetic ones, particularly in the mining industry.

The process begins with the crushing of ore, which is then poured over a rotating drum that contains a fixed magnet.

As the crushed ore is distributed over the drum, the magnetic ore, also known as ferrous material, is attracted to the magnet. This allows the magnetic particles to be held by the drum.

The non-magnetic waste material falls off the drum due to gravity as it rotates, thus separating it from the magnetic particles.

The gathered magnetic ore can now be collected separately, leading to a more efficient extraction process, especially in the context of mining iron.
